Soccer: Washington State 3, Idaho 1

Having the game delayed a day due to the smoky conditions in the area didn’t do Idaho any favors Monday night.

Washington State (2-0) was able to handle the Vandals (1-1) easily in Pullman 3-1 after a shaky first half by Idaho.

Still, Idaho head coach Derek Pittman was still pleased with how the team played in its second game of the season, which was against a Pac-12 school.

“(The game) was good and WSU is a fantastic team,” Pittman said. “I give them a lot of credit. They moved the ball well in the first half.”

Idaho’s one goal came in the 36th minute from Kayleigh Fredrick on an assist from Clara Gomez. It was the last goal of the match.

“I’m very proud of our kids, of their effort how they stood up for themselves,” Pittman said. “We will take a lot of confidence from this into next Friday.”

The Vandals play former conference-foe New Mexico State 5 p.m. Friday at Guy Wicks Field.
